Output 955566d4409a04bdc9d13f5f6133c3bc4dbd7ca417dcc7792a71a768f475c51b:0

value
289208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2342948556bc202e717262a8c94910218a516d0 OP_EQUAL
address
3PmfwCEsYgj1odGZY9KmNBzkR5LZa1ZLyW
transaction
955566d4409a04bdc9d13f5f6133c3bc4dbd7ca417dcc7792a71a768f475c51b
confirmations
204669
spent
true